The Xavier Institute of Development Action and Studies (XIDAS) in Jabalpur, Madhya Pradesh is a private institution:
Type of institution: Private, registered society run by the Jesuits of Madhya Pradesh Province
Founded: 1995 by Fr. Michael Van then Bogaert, SJ
Courses: Diploma courses in Business & Management Studies
Specializations: PGDM and PGDM-RM programs in Human Resource, Marketing and Finance, and Rural Management

The highest package offered at Xavier Institute of Management and Research (XIMR) in Mumbai has ranged from 11–14 Lacs per annum (LPA):
2020 batch: The highest package was 14 LPA, while the lowest was 4.5 LPA.
2021–2023: The highest salary was 11 LPA.
Some other details about placements at XIMR include:
The average salary for the top 30% of offers was 8 LPA.
The average salary was 6 LPA.
Top recruiting brands include HDFC Bank, HDFC Ltd, Lynk, Decinal point, Kantar group, Reliance,
and ipsos.

Some notable alumni of Xavier Institute of Management, Bhubaneswar (XIMB) include:
Piyush Shrivastva: Batch 1997, currently Vice President of Business Development Asia at Pernod Ricord
Srikumar Misra: Batch 2001, founder of Milk Mantra and winner of the 2019 McNulty Award
Yeshwanth Nag Mocherla: Batch 2012, co-founder of The ThickShake Factory and winner of the “QSR brand of the year- National” award
XIMB is a leading B-school that focuses on research and innovation. In 2022, Education World Institute ranked XIMB 8th in India's Top 100 Private B-schools.
